Though she's the daughter of the late gifted composer Henry Mancini, Monica Mancini sings in a voice that makes it clear she has many special talents of her own. Originally aired as a PBS special, this program was taped during Mancini's recent performance at UCLA's Royce Hall and during studio recording sessions. She sings some classic songs of her father's, such as "Moon River," "The Days of Wine and Roses," and "Charade." She even sings a recovered Henry Mancini melody, complete with lyrics written by Will Jennings. ~ Elizabeth Smith, Rovi
